Ashley Moore scores 22 to lead Lowellville past JFK in Division IV


HUBBARD — Ashley Moore scored 22 points, including 12 in the first quarter, to lead the Lowellville High girls basketball team to a 61-49 victory over Warren JFK in a sectional championship game at the Division IV tournament.

Emily Carlson added 14 points for the Rockets (18-4), who led 16-9 after the opening period and 28-23 at halftime. Taylor Hvisdak scored 11 points and Chelsie Marrie finished with 10.

Gabby Lee scored 16 points to lead JFK (8-13) and Paige Klaric added 13.

Leetonia 43, Sebring 39

HUBBARD — Leetonia was outscored 30-23 on field goals, but held a 20-9 advantage at the free throw line to advance to a district semifinal game Thursday against Lowellville.

Gina Jones of Leetonia (10-11) led all scorers with 16 points and was 8-for-10 at the foul line. The Bears were 20-of-31 on charity tosses.

Sebring (10-12) was led by Maggie Householder who scored 12 points.

AUSTINTOWN — Brittany Ritchie scored 25 points and Amy Scullion added 22 to lead Salem over Niles, 66-22, in a sectional championship game at Fitch High School.

The Quakers (17-4) bolted out to a 21-5 lead after the first quarter and were in control, 40-11, at halftime.

Salem advanced to play Chagrin Falls Kenston on Thursday at 6 p.m. in a district semifinal.

Megan McDermott led Niles (0-21) with five points. Mariah Mostoller added four points.

Canfield 62, Southeast 30

AUSTINTOWN — Canfield (14-8) led only 19-13 after the first quarter, but outscored Southeast 20-2 in the second period to lead 39-15 at halftime.

Kalie Luklan sank a two 3-pointers as part of her team-high 14 point effort. Jillian Halfhill added 13 points for the Cardinals, who advanced to meet Struthers on Thursday at 7:30 p.m. in a district semifinal. Canfield defeated Struthers, 56-53, in a regular season game on Dec. 3.

Mya Levels, a 6-foot-2 senior, led Southeast with 22 points, including all nine the Pirates (7-14) scored in the second and third quarters, combined.

Harding 67, Brecksville 59

SOLON — Jasmine Kirkland scored 22 points and grabbed eight rebounds while Aundrea Baldridge had 18 points to lead Warren Harding (18-4), in a Division I sectional final at Solon High.

The Raiders outscored Brecksville in the final quarter by 22-11 to rally from a 48-45 deficit to the win.

DeAundra Maddox had 17 points for Brecksville while Alisa Blumenthaler contributed nine points and as many rebounds.

Warren Harding will next play Shaker Heights in a district semifinal at Solon. That game will be Thursday at 7:30 p.m., following the Howland-Twinsburg game.

WARREN — Warren Harding concluded its regular season with an 18-2 record by defeating Mentor, 74-72, at the Harding Fieldhouse on Saturday night.

Warren Harding is the No.l 1 seed at the sectional-district tournament at Warrensville Heights High School.

The Raiders will have a bye in the first round, then open tournament play against either Solon or Cleveland John Adams on March 7 at 6 p.m.
